Output 40b955cf40d7a23f91ff7f4e8a9012b40284c16f94450ca71b3cd24fbdc1609a:47

value
150530838
script pubkey
OP_0 OP_PUSHBYTES_20 acfa6a1181a9bed67415b28be43055c2df81db2e
address
bc1q4nax5yvp4xldvaq4k297gvz4ct0crkew9snmcj
transaction
40b955cf40d7a23f91ff7f4e8a9012b40284c16f94450ca71b3cd24fbdc1609a
spent
true